WebOxford House Self-run, Self-supported Recovery Houses Click here to watch the 2024 convention live stream A live stream will be available for most of the convention sessions … The Headington Shark (proper name Untitled 1986) is a rooftop sculpture located at 2 New High Street, Headington, Oxford, England, depicting a large shark embedded head-first in the roof of a house. It was protest art, put up without permission, to be symbolic of bombs crashing into buildings. See more The shark first appeared on 9 August 1986, having been commissioned by the house's owner Bill Heine, a local radio presenter. WebMay 19, 2024 · The Oxfordshire County Council attempted to remove the shark on the grounds that it may be unsafe for the public and occupants of the house. However upon inspection, the specialist roof supports installed to hold the shark were deemed safe and it was able to stay.
